Emre steps closer to Toon
By European Football
May 29 2005
Inter Milan star Emre yesterday took a step closer to Newcastle United by admitting that he would like to join them and saying he has a lot of respect for manager Graham Souness.
Speaking to the Corrie della Sera, Emre stated:
“I have had contact off several clubs, but a move to England interests me the most at this time. Although a move back to Turkey cannot be out ruled, I feel that I am seeking a new challenge and England will give me that.”
“Newcastle would be an interesting move, I have a lot of time for their manager and it’s a club that has not had the success it perhaps deserves. I spoke to some of the Turkish lads who played in England and they all agreed that the atmosphere and the fans there are something special, it would be an honour for me to play for a club like that.”
He refused to be drawn on his argument with the current Inter boss simply saying.
“These sorts of things get blown out of proportion, but yes I think it’s almost certain I am to leave, I will be sad of course to do so, this is a great club. But it is the right time.”
